5.04.030 Evidence of doing business.
   When any person by use of signs, circulars, cards, telephone book, or newspapers, advertises, holds out, or represents that such person is conducting a business within the city, or when any person holds an active license or permit issued by a governmental agency indicating that such person is in business within the city, and such person fails to deny by a sworn statement given to the business license officer that he or she is not conducting a business within the city, after being requested to do so by the business license officer, then the foregoing facts shall be considered prima facie evidence that such person is conducting a business within the city. (Ord. 3 § 1 (part), 1991: prior code § 5.02.005)
